Mahalaxmi Racecourse To Become Mumbai Central Public Park, Inspired By NYC

The Maharashtra government is planning to create a world-class 'Mumbai Central Public Park' at the Mahalaxmi Racecourse. This new park in Mumbai will be inspired by New York's Central Park. On Wednesday, a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) was signed between the BMC and the Royal Western India Turf Club Ltd.

Mumbai s New Green Landmark Central Public Park

Maharashtra Chief Minister Eknath Shinde mentioned that the park aims to offer Mumbaikars a green space similar to New York's Central Park. He added that this project is part of a broader plan to enhance urban green cover and improve life quality for Mumbai's residents.

The 'Mumbai Central Public Park' will adhere to international standards, making it a landmark in the city. The design will include sustainable practices and modern amenities to meet diverse needs. This project represents a significant move towards increasing green spaces in Mumbai.

The park will be developed on the current Mahalaxmi Racecourse grounds, turning it into a lush public area. It is expected to provide various recreational facilities and green zones for both residents and visitors.

The transformation of the Mahalaxmi Racecourse into a public park is a notable milestone. The new park will feature jogging tracks, cycling tracks, and spaces for cultural events, according to the Maharashtra government.

'Mumbai Central Public Park' as a Major Attraction

The BMC plans to complete the project in phases over several years, ensuring minimal disruption during development. Once finished, the 'Mumbai Central Public Park' is set to become one of Mumbai's major attractions.

The park will benefit the local community by providing a venue for outdoor activities and social gatherings. It will also serve as an educational space with botanical gardens and environmental awareness programs.
